首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

仅为某些部分更改WPF标签中的字体粗细

WPF(Windows Presentation Foundation)是微软的一种用户界面技术,可以用于开发Windows桌面应用程序。它提供了一种灵活且可定制的方式来创建各种各样的图形用户界面,同时支持在应用程序中使用不同字体的粗细。

在WPF中更改标签(Label)中的字体粗细可以通过设置Label控件的FontWeight属性来实现。FontWeight属性用于控制字体的粗细程度,它有以下几个常用的值:

  1. Normal:表示正常字体,即不加粗。
  2. Bold:表示加粗字体。
  3. Thin:表示细字体。
  4. ExtraLight:表示特别细字体。
  5. Light:表示较细字体。
  6. Medium:表示中等粗细字体。
  7. SemiBold:表示半粗字体。
  8. ExtraBold:表示特别粗字体。
  9. Black:表示黑体字。

通过设置Label的FontWeight属性,可以选择适合的字体粗细样式,以满足设计需求。

在WPF中,可以使用XAML或代码来设置Label的FontWeight属性。以下是使用XAML和代码分别设置Label字体粗细的示例:

XAML示例:

代码语言:txt
复制
<Label Content="Hello, World!" FontWeight="Bold" />

代码示例:

代码语言:txt
复制
Label label = new Label();
label.Content = "Hello, World!";
label.FontWeight = FontWeights.Bold;

以上示例中,Label的Content属性设置为"Hello, World!",FontWeight属性设置为Bold,表示要显示加粗的字体。

在WPF应用程序中,更改标签中字体粗细的应用场景非常广泛。例如,在设计用户界面时,可以根据需求选择不同的字体粗细样式来突出显示某些重要的文本或标题,提高可读性和视觉效果。

腾讯云提供了多种云计算相关产品,其中包括云服务器、云数据库、云存储等,这些产品可用于支持WPF应用程序的部署和运行。具体的腾讯云产品介绍和相关链接地址,请参考腾讯云官方文档:

  1. 云服务器:提供可靠、安全的云端计算服务,支持多种操作系统和应用程序。详情请查看腾讯云云服务器产品介绍:https://cloud.tencent.com/product/cvm
  2. 云数据库:提供稳定可靠的云端数据库服务,包括关系型数据库和NoSQL数据库等。详情请查看腾讯云云数据库产品介绍:https://cloud.tencent.com/product/cdb
  3. 云存储:提供高可靠、低成本的云端存储服务,用于存储和管理各种类型的数据。详情请查看腾讯云云存储产品介绍:https://cloud.tencent.com/product/cos

请注意,以上链接仅为示例,实际应根据具体需求和情况选择适合的腾讯云产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【愚公系列】2023年10月 WPF控件专题 TabControl控件详解

欢迎 点赞✍评论⭐收藏前言WPF控件是Windows Presentation Foundation(WPF基本用户界面元素。它们是可视化对象,可以用来创建各种用户界面。...一、TabControl控件详解TabControl控件是WPF中常用容器控件之一,用于显示多个选项卡,每个选项卡可以包含不同内容。...--选项卡-->更改选项卡样式TabControl控件选项卡样式可以通过修改TabControl控件模板来实现。在模板,可以自定义选项卡外观、标题、关闭按钮等。...BorderThickness:设置TabControl边框厚度。FontSize:设置TabControl字体大小。FontWeight:设置TabControl字体粗细。...2.常用场景WPFTabControl控件常用于以下场景:标签页管理:TabControl控件可以用于管理多个标签页,用户可以通过标签页切换方式来浏览不同内容。

85600

假装可变字体

但普通字体可达不到这种效果,例如微软雅黑,无论怎么调整它 FontWeight,实际上它也只有三种粗细: 这时候我们需要可变字体,可变字体(Variable fonts)是OpenType字体规范上演进...,它允许将同一字体多个变体统合进单独字体文件。...从而无需再将不同字宽、字重或不同样式字体分割成不同字体文件。你只需通过CSS与一行@font-face引用,即可获取包含在这个单一文件各种字体变体。...假装可变字体 可是我不知道怎么在 WPF 里用可变字体,而且为了一个小小按钮小小动画,居然要添加一个几十兆大小字体,这性价比实在低,低到不能接受。...更多关于 WPF 设计和动画技巧,可以参考我这个项目: https://github.com/DinoChan/wpf_design_and_animation_lab

60220

Qt 第一步 HelloWorld 第一个程序

开始写Qt 相关文章主要原因是,我本人在编写一个视频录制及相关处理项目,写到一半发现.net winform 相关UI处理限制较大;虽然我也可以使用WPF 进行编写,但是我本人并没有接触过WPF...在出现窗体,项目选择 Application 应用程序,在中间内容部分,选择 Qt Widgets Application。别选错,如选择了Console项目将会是控制台应用程序。 ?...在项目内容,有一个层级结构,顶层是一个Hello,展开后分为如下部分: 后缀为 .pro 文件:项目管理文件,例如项目设置项 Headers:包含项目头文件,mainwindow.h 为主窗口类头文件...如图所示,左侧当前区域显示为设计,这时将可以设计当前主窗口UI界面,在左侧小部件中找到lable 标签拖拽至设计窗体。 ?...当然我们也可以更改字体大小,在右下角属性面板,找到 font 相关属性: ? 如图点击设置可以更改字体大小,在粗体、下划线等选项勾选即可拥有相关属性。

1.1K20

Qt 第一步 HelloWorld 第一个程序

开始写Qt 相关文章主要原因是,我本人在编写一个视频录制及相关处理项目,写到一半发现.net winform 相关UI处理限制较大;虽然我也可以使用WPF 进行编写,但是我本人并没有接触过WPF...[在这里插入图片描述] 在出现窗体,项目选择 Application 应用程序,在中间内容部分,选择 Qt Widgets Application。...为当前主窗口界面文件,双击打开: [在这里插入图片描述] 如图所示,左侧当前区域显示为设计,这时将可以设计当前主窗口UI界面,在左侧小部件中找到lable 标签拖拽至设计窗体。...[在这里插入图片描述] 双击label标签(在windows设计窗体上显示为TextLable),输入内容为HelloWorld: [在这里插入图片描述] 当然我们也可以更改字体大小,在右下角属性面板...,找到 font 相关属性: [在这里插入图片描述] 如图点击设置可以更改字体大小,在粗体、下划线等选项勾选即可拥有相关属性。

61910

【前端就业课 第二阶段】CSS 零基础到实战(02)标签类型、字体与图片

1.1 块元素 块元素有比较多特性,例如在 HTML 页面呈现为独占一行,例如标题标签 、、 这些,当然也包括 标签元素这一类,这一类标签在页面独占一个行,你在后面所编写内容将会自动换行显示...在块元素还可以包含 块元素、行内元素、行内块元素,但是文字类型元素内不能包含块元素,例如 h 、p 标签。 一般常见块元素有标题标签 h、p、 div、有无序列表li与ol 等。...例如有一个 p 标签如下: 离离原上草 万里入海流 玉琼更上一层楼 此时页面显示字体为默认字体: 若想使其更改字体设置...标签字体设置时,其大小设置为 2个 em,那么一个 em 就是60px,那么就表名其 p 标签字体为 120 px。...2.3 字体粗细 在 css 设置字体粗细如下: p{ font-weight: bold; } 其中 bold 选值还有normal

1.1K10

从头学前端-CSS基础01

属性;(不要使用纯数字,中文,标签名作为类名)使用时候,class前面加符号.语法如下:.类名{ k:v}一个标签页可以使用多个类名;在标签class属性,写多个类名,以空格分开;id选择器是通过标签...Id属性值作为选择器,id以#开始;其他与类选择器类似;相比类选择器,id可以表示一个标签,id只能使用一次;通配符选择器使用*定义,它表示选取页面所有的元素;图片CSS字体属性字体属性用于定义字体系列...,大小,粗细和文字样式等;字体系列:font-family字体大小: font-size; 大小以px(像素)为单位;谷歌浏览器默认大小为16px; 一般情况下给body添加此属性;标题标签特殊设置字体粗细...{font-style(可省略) font-weight(可省略) font-size(必需)/line-height font-family(必需) } 空格隔开,顺序不可以更改CSS文本属性...一个页面的搭建过程搭建页面html结构> 根据页面展示内容,设置页面标签添加CSS样式> 添加body全局css 添加各个标签样式注意图片标签没有水平居中样式,如要水平居中,需要放到行标签,如p和div

1.1K00

第06步《前端篇》第2章打造游戏界面第1课

); 学习使用const关键字,及添加注释; 学习更改绘制文本字体、字号与颜色; 了解常用中文字体英文名称; 学习给绘制文本添加文本样式(斜体、粗体); 学习给绘制文本添加渐变色材质; 学习在Canvas...在HTML标记代码,一个很重要概念是属性,例如id是标签身份属性,lang是标签语言属性。 CSS是一种样式描述语言,作用就是装饰、打扮HTML组件。...CSS语法为分两部分,花括号外面是选择器,代表对谁应用样式描述;花括号里面是样式描述代码,每组样式都是成对出现,冒号(:)前面是样式名,后面是样式值。 在JS代码,等号代表赋值。...measureText方法返回尺寸信息并不包含高度信息,文本高度信息手动计算涉及到许多内容,但对于大多数字体而言,其字符M宽度值近似等于其高度值,所以M字符宽度值可以近似当作同字体高度值使用...实践疑难点 font-weight一般建议直接使用绝对粗细数字值,而不是相对粗细名称值。在网页根元素设置font-weight不同,所有子元素相对值都会受到影响。

1K20

CSS 基础 之 基础选择器+字体文本相关样式

2、CSS引入方式 内嵌式 CSS 写在style标签 外联式 CSS 写在一个单独.css文件 行内式 CSS 写在标签style属性 2.1 内嵌式 style标签虽然可以写在页面任意位置...代码演示: 2.2 外联式 需要通过link标签在网页引入。 2.3 行内式 3、基础选择器 选择页面对应标签(找她),方便后续设置样式(改她)。...4.2 字体粗细 属性名 font-weight 取值 关键字: 正常——>normal 加粗 ——>bold纯数字:100~900整百数:正常——>400 加粗 ——>700 注意点 不是所有字体都提供了九种粗细...,因此部分取值页面无变化实际开发以:正常、加粗两种取值使用最多。...关键字: 正常——>normal 加粗 ——>bold 纯数字:100~900整百数:正常——>400 加粗 ——>700 注意点 不是所有字体都提供了九种粗细,因此部分取值页面无变化 实际开发

2.1K10

dotnet OpenXML WPF 解析实现 PPT 文本描边效果

本文是使用 WPF 做个 PowerPoint 系列博客,本文来告诉大家如何解析 PPT 里面的文本描边效果,在 WPF 应用绘制出来,实现像素级相同 背景知识 在开始之前,期望你了解了 PPT 解析入门知识...如对 PPT 解析了解很少,请参阅 C# dotnet 使用 OpenXml 解析 PPT 文件 在 PPT 里面可以给文本某些文字设置描边效果,描边效果从 OpenXML 层上是不属于特效,只是属于边框属性...SlideParts.First().Slide; 本文以下代码,为了方便告诉大家核心部分逻辑,将根据 Test.pptx 文档进行忽略很多参数判断。...> 咱所关注基本只有粗细和颜色,获取方法分别如下 var outlineWidth = new Emu(outline.Width!....; 通过 win10 uwp 颜色转换 方法可以将 colorText 转换为 SolidColorBrush 对象 再获取文本内容,大概就完成了 // 默认字体前景色是黑色

96120

通过CSS设置字体样式

字体样式 (双标签):没有任何语义标签,通常和CSS结合使用。 font-family 设置字体类型 <!...} 浏览器显示 font-weight 设置字体粗细 div span{ font-family: 宋体; font-size: 24px;...font-style:italic; font-weight:bold; } 浏览器显示 这样设置嫌麻烦还可以在一个声明设置所有字体属性 浏览器显示 字体属性顺序...:字体风格→字体粗细字体大小→字体类型; 总结 font-family——设置字体类型——font-family:"宋体"; font-size——设置字体大小——font-size:12px; font-style...——设置字体风格——font-style:italic; font-weight——设置字体粗细——font-weight:bold; font——一个声明设置所有字体属性——font:italic

6K10

css基础第一弹

CSS规则由两个主要部分构成:选择器以及一条或多条声明。...--页面字体都会变成30px--> 基础选择器总结 基础选择器 作用 特点 使用情况 用法 标签选择器 可以所有相同标签,比如p 不能差异化选择 较多 p {color:red;} 类选择器 可以选出一个或多个标签...;} 通配符选择器 选择所有标签 选择太多,很多不需要 特殊情况使用 *{color:red;} 字体 字体属性 CSS Fonts (字体)属性用于定义字体系列、大小、粗细、和文字样式(如斜体)...(chrome浏览器默认文字大小为16px),我们尽量给一个明确大小 可以给body标签指定整个页面大小 字体粗细 CSS 使用font-weight属性设置文本字体粗细。...p { font-style: normal; } 属性值 描述 normal 默认值,显示标准字体样式 italic 浏览器会显示倾斜字体样式 字体复合属性 字体系列、大小、粗细、和文字样式

1.9K20

CSS字体font

字体大小 font-size 设置字体大小 ,px 是一个单位,代表屏幕像素,在css大多数数值都需要添加单位 font-size: 12px; 字体粗细 font-weight 设置字体粗细...,取值:默认(normal) 、加粗(bold)、 100 - 900 font-weight:bold 因为字体在初始设计时候就没有设置太多粗细标准,用数字设置时候,只有在400和700会产生变化...,在实际工作最多就是normal(400) bold(700) 字体风格 font-style 设置字体风格(样式) 取值:normal 默认 显示标准字体样式 italic 字体倾斜...font-family:"宋体"; 字体可以写多个,中间用逗号隔开,浏览器会从左到右依次解析,直到识别出当前电脑安装字体则直接使用,字体名称如果有空格 # $ 这种特殊字符时候需要添加上引号 中文字体也需要添加引号...,那么这个标签里面的文字可以在这个标签里面垂直居中 两者结合使用可以让单行文字在标签内部水平垂直居中 文字对齐 text-align:值; 取值:left right center 该属性控制标签

2.9K30

css基础第一弹

CSS规则由两个主要部分构成:选择器以及一条或多条声明。...--页面字体都会变成30px--> 基础选择器总结 基础选择器 作用 特点 使用情况 用法 标签选择器 可以所有相同标签,比如p 不能差异化选择 较多 p {color:red;} 类选择器 可以选出一个或多个标签...;} 通配符选择器 选择所有标签 选择太多,很多不需要 特殊情况使用 *{color:red;} 字体 字体属性 CSS Fonts (字体)属性用于定义字体系列、大小、粗细、和文字样式(如斜体)...不同浏览器默认字体大小是不一样(chrome浏览器默认文字大小为16px),我们尽量给一个明确大小 可以给body标签指定整个页面大小 字体粗细 CSS 使用font-weight属性设置文本字体粗细...字体粗细 加粗是bold或700,不加粗是normal或400,数字后不跟单位 font-style 字体样式 倾斜是italic,不倾斜是normal,常用于取消倾斜 font 字体连写 字体连写是有顺序

5510

HTML、CSS温故而知新

HTML、CSS 温故而知新 参加字节跳动青训营时写笔记。这部分是韩广军老师讲课。 前端: 前端需要关注东西: 功能 美观 安全 兼容 体验 性能 无障碍 1....HTML 用于创建网页标准标记语言 1.1 HTML 语法 标签和属性不区分大小写,但是推荐小写 部分标签可以不闭合,如 input、meta 属性值推荐使用双引号包裹 属性值为 true 时,可以省略属性值...强调,表示内容重要性 em:斜体强调标签,更强烈强调,表示内容强调点 1.3 语义化 ​ HTML 元素、属性及属性值都拥有某种含义,如有序列表用 ol,无序列表用 ul....id (伪)类 标签 1 2 2 .box ul.links a: id (伪)类 标签 0 2 2 2.3 字体 2.3.1 字体族 font-family font-family 使用建议...字体粗细 font-weight font-weight: 100-900 normal(400), bold(700) 2.3.4 行高 line-height 用于设置多行元素空间量 如果 line-height

89610

css(2)

; } 可以更改整个body字体,也可以只更改某一行字体,以及字体大小。...1.2.3font-weight 值 描述 normal 默认值,标准粗细 bold 粗体 bolder 更粗 lighter 更细(更淡) 100~900 设置具体粗细 inherit 继承父元素字体粗细...这里需要说明,上面这些都是font-weight属性,具体用法和上面的字体字体大小用法相同。...一般用于配合JavaScript代码使用 block 默认占满整个页面宽度,如果设置了指定宽度,则会用margin填充剩下部分,使行内元素变成块级元素 inline 按行内元素显示,此时再设置元素width...1.8float(浮动) 在css任何元素都可以浮动,浮动特点: 浮动框可以左右移动,直到碰到网页边框或者另一个浮动框,浮动框可以覆盖固定框,而且浮动框会把原来框占有的位置让出来。

1.5K20
领券